2025 Edition: Harness the power of HTML5 and CSS to create a single UI that works flawlessly on mobile phones, tablets, and desktops, including everything in-between. Now with color images Key Features Understand what responsive web design is and learn to design effective, accessible and future-proof front-end applications Explore the newest CSS features like view transitions, scroll-linked animations, wide gamut colors, and CSS functions Learn brand-new time-saving additions to the HTML language, including dialogs and modals Book DescriptionResponsive Web Design with HTML5 and CSS, Fifth Edition, is the very latest, up-to-date version of one of the most comprehensive and bestselling books on HTML5 and CSS techniques for responsive web design. It emphasizes pragmatic application, teaching you all about the approaches needed to build most real-life websites, with downloadable examples for every chapter. Written in author Ben's friendly and easy-to-follow style, this title can be read as a complete guide or used to dip in as a reference for each topic-focused chapter. It covers all the cutting-edge and modern developments in responsive design and the HTML and CSS languages. It includes methods for better accessibility, techniques for using variable fonts, the latest color manipulation tools, and color spaces now usable in modern browsers. Throughout the book, you'll enjoy in-depth coverage of bleeding-edge features such as scroll-linked animations, view transitions, CSS anchor positioning, CSS layers, functions, container queries, nesting, and more. Get exclusive tips and approaches for frontend development, including how to validate the effectiveness of AI generated code. By the end of this book, you'll not only have a thorough understanding of responsive web design and what's possible with the latest HTML5 and CSS, but also know how to best implement each technique.What you will learn Employ color functions to mix colors and convert between color spaces Use media and container queries to detect things like touch/mouse and color preference within CSS Leverage HTML semantics to author accessible markup Use SVGs to provide resolution-independent images and learn the most efficient way of displaying them Discover CSS custom properties and learn to make use of new CSS functions, including clamp, min, and max Add validation and interface elements to HTML forms Check whether the frontend code produced by AI tools is effective for your goals Who this book is forAre you a full-stack or backend developer who needs to improve their front-end skills? Perhaps you work on the frontend and need a definitive overview of all that modern HTML and CSS has to offer? Maybe you have done a little website building, but you need a deep understanding of responsive web designs and how to achieve them? Perhaps you are using AI tools to produce code and want to check the output? If any of those scenarios sound familiar-this is the book for you! All you need to take advantage of this book is a working understanding of HTML and CSS. No JavaScript knowledge is needed.
About the AuthorBen Frain has been a web designer/developer since 1996. He is currently employed as a UI-UX Technical Lead at bet365. Before the web, he worked as an underrated (and modest) TV actor and technology journalist, having graduated from Salford University with a degree in Media and Performance. He has written four equally underrated (his opinion) screenplays and still harbors the (fading) belief he might sell one. Outside of work, he enjoys simple pleasures: books, films and raising a family.
Book InformationISBN 9781837028238
Author Ben FrainFormat Paperback
Imprint Packt Publishing LimitedPublisher Packt Publishing Limited